About Bose

Bose Corporation traces its roots to 1964, when MIT professor Amar Gopal Bose founded the company in Natick, Massachusetts, after growing disillusioned with the poor performance of a high-end stereo system he purchased as a graduate student. Driven by a passion for replicating the immersive qualities of live music through rigorous acoustic research, Bose launched the venture with initial contracts for the U.S. military and NASA, emphasizing innovative speaker designs that prioritized indirect, reverberant sound over direct radiation. This American heritage, rooted in psychoacoustics and engineering excellence, has defined the brand's pursuit of "Better Sound Through Research."

Bose excels in consumer and professional audio categories, renowned for its home audio systems, premium speakers like the iconic 901 Series, and pioneering noise-canceling headphones first prototyped in the 1980s for pilots. The lineup extends to vehicle sound systems, portable Bluetooth speakers, and professional installations, but steers clear of niche hi-fi components such as amplifiers, turntables, DACs, or cables, focusing instead on integrated, user-friendly solutions that blend advanced signal processing with spatial audio reproduction.

Positioned as a premium mid-tier powerhouse in the global market, Bose commands widespread appeal among discerning buyers seeking accessible high-performance audio without audiophile esoterica. Its reputation for innovation and reliability has built a loyal following, though purists occasionally critique its measured sound signature, cementing Bose as a dominant force in mainstream hi-fi rather than high-end boutique or vintage realms.
